Nahum 1:7

Viewing the King James Version. Click to switch to 1611 King James Version of Nahum 1:7.


The LORD is good, a strong hold in the day of trouble; and he knoweth them that trust in him.


- King James Bible "Authorized Version", Cambridge Edition

Other Translations of Nahum 1:7

The Lord is good, a strong hold in the day of trouble, & he knoweth them that trust in him.
- King James Version (1611) - View 1611 Bible Scan

The LORD is good, A stronghold in the day of trouble, And He knows those who take refuge in Him.
- New American Standard Version (1995)

Jehovah is good, a stronghold in the day of trouble; and he knoweth them that take refuge in him.
- American Standard Version (1901)

The Lord is good, a strong place in the day of trouble; and he has knowledge of those who take him for their safe cover.
- Basic English Bible

Jehovah is good, a stronghold in the day of trouble; and he knoweth them that trust in him.
- Darby Bible

The LORD is good, a strong hold in the day of trouble; and he knoweth them that trust in him.
- Webster's Bible

Yahweh is good, a stronghold in the day of trouble; and he knows those who take refuge in him.
- World English Bible

Good [is] Jehovah for a strong place in a day of distress. And He knoweth those trusting in Him.
- Youngs Literal Bible

The LORD is good, a stronghold in the day of trouble; and He knoweth them that take refuge in Him.
- Jewish Publication Society Bible

 

View Wesley's Notes for Nahum 1:7

1:7 Knoweth - He approves, owns, and preserves them.
